Reformer Pilates is a form of low-impact, intentional movement focused on building strength through controlled, resistance-based exercises performed on a specialized piece of equipment called the reformer. Using springs, straps, breath, alignment, and core engagement, movements are designed to help you move with more stability, awareness, and ease.
Unlike fast-paced workouts that can leave the body feeling overwhelmed, Reformer Pilates emphasizes mindful movement patterns that support long-term strength, posture, flexibility, and mobility. The adjustable resistance of the reformer allows for both support and challenge, helping you move with precision while building strength throughout the entire body.
Through consistent practice, Reformer Pilates can help improve core strength, support balance, reduce tension, and create a stronger foundation for everyday movement. Whether you're beginning your movement journey, returning after time away, or looking for a practice that feels supportive and sustainable, Reformer Pilates meets you where you're at while offering opportunities to grow with every session.

This four-week series is designed to help you reconnect with your body, become familiar with the reformer, build strength intentionally, and move with greater confidence - all in a supportive, small-group environment.
Each week will build upon the last through thoughtful movement, deeper core connection, posture work, strength training, and full-body flow.
Week 1: Root - breath, alignment, and foundations
Week 2: Stabilize - balance, control, and support
Week 3: Strengthen - resistance, endurance, and confidence
Week 4: Rise - integration, fluid movement, and empowerment
Whether you’re brand new to reformer or looking to deepen your practice, this series offers a slower, more intentional approach to movement that leaves you feeling grounded, capable, and connected to your body again.
